ABSTRACT
Long-term research on the intensification of economically significant pests in rape cultivation has been conducted by the Plant Protection Institute – National Research Institute (PPI – NRI) Poznań, Poland. This research has allowed for a determination of the economic effectiveness of chemical plant protection against pests. The research was conducted during the 2006–2009 time period. Results showed that the economic effectiveness expressed in approximate profitability indexes E 1 and E 2 in rape cultivation in Poland was diversified. The values were influenced by the selling prices of rape, intensification of pest occurrence, and yield. To prevent losses in yields, chemical crop protection has been implemented. In 2006, rape underwent an average of two treatments against pests: one against diseases and one reducing weed infestation. The primary rape-attacking pests from 2006 to 2009 were: rape pollen beetle ( Meligethes aeneus F.), cabbage stem weevil ( Ceutorhynous quadridenz Penz), cabbage seed weevil ( Ceutrohynorus assimillis Payk.) and pod gall midge ( Dasyneura brassicae Winn.).
